Housewife Remanded For Recording Man & Sending Him Text Messages

A 37-year old housewife, Patience Ezeokonkwo, has been arrested and charged in Lagos State for conduct likely to cause breach of public peace for allegedly recording a man, Chibuzor Joseph, on video and sending text messages to him.

 

P.M.EXPRESS reports that the incident happened at Unity Street, Isheri Oshun area of Lagos, while the complainant, Joseph, was going to his site.

 

Following the alleged video recording and text messages, Joseph went to the Police at Isheri Oshun Division and reported that Mrs. Patience Ezeokonkwo was threatening his life and family including recording him and his friend,  Augustine Ndubueze.

 

Thus, the Police arrested Patience Ezeokonkwo and detained her at the station for interrogation over her alleged conduct.

During interrogation, the complainant brought out the text messages Patience sent to him through her WhatsApp phone number.

 

But the complainant did not disclose how she got his phone number to which she sent the messages and how he knew that her husband was in Edo State.

 

However, the Police found Patience culpable for the alleged offence under the Criminal laws of the State.

She pleaded not guilty when she was arraigned.

 

The prosecutor, Supol Benedict Aigbokhan, then asked the Court to give a date for hearing since she pleaded not guilty to enable the Police to prove that she actually committed the alleged offence.

 

The Presiding Magistrate, Mrs. K.A. Ariyo, granted her bail in the sum of N200,000 with two sureties in like sum, who must show evidence of means of livelihood and tax payment while addresses will be verified by the Court.

 

The matter was adjourned till 7th October, 2024, for mention while the defendant was remanded in custody at the correctional center at Kirikiri town, Lagos, pending when she will perfect her bail conditions.
